| In core_info_read and inst_info_read in all Android releases from CAF using the Linux kernel, variable "dbg_buf", "dbg_buf->curr" and "dbg_buf->filled_size" could be modified by different threads at the same time, but they are not protected with mutex or locks. Buffer overflow is possible on race conditions. "buffer->curr" itself could also be overwritten, which means that it may point to anywhere of kernel memory (for write). |

| Race condition in net/packet/af_packet.c in the Linux kernel before 4.9.13 allows local users to cause a denial of service (use-after-free) or possibly have unspecified other impact via a multithreaded application that makes PACKET_FANOUT setsockopt system calls. |

| Wings is the server control plane for Pterodactyl Panel. This vulnerability impacts anyone running the affected versions of Wings. The vulnerability can potentially be used to access files and directories on the host system. The full scope of impact is exactly unknown, but reading files outside of a server's base directory (sandbox root) is possible. In order to use this exploit, an attacker must have an existing "server" allocated and controlled by Wings. Details on the exploitation of this vulnerability are embargoed until March 27th, 2024 at 18:00 UTC. In order to mitigate this vulnerability, a full rewrite of the entire server filesystem was necessary. Because of this, the size of the patch is massive, however effort was made to reduce the amount of breaking changes. Users are advised to update to version 1.11.9. There are no known workarounds for this vulnerability. |
